Understanding The Goodman 4 Ton AC Unit

Goodman is recognized for its balance of quality, efficiency, and affordability. The 4 ton central air conditioner is suitable for homes measuring approximately 2,000 to 2,400 square feet. Buyers should weigh features, warranty options, and energy efficiency before purchasing.

Key Features Of Goodman 4 Ton Units

  • SEER Ratings: Usually ranges from 14 to 18 SEER, which impacts energy efficiency.
  • Compressor Type: Available in single-stage and two-stage compressors.
  • Warranty: Goodman offers limited parts and compressor warranties, often up to 10 years.
  • Durability: Units built with heavy-gauge galvanized steel and baked-on powder paint to resist rust.
  • Quiet Operation: Advanced sound reduction technology available in some models.

Goodman 4 Ton AC Unit Price Overview

The cost of a Goodman 4 ton AC unit alone (without installation) tends to fall within a certain range. Price is influenced by model, efficiency (SEER rating), and retailer markup. See below for a comparison table.

Model SEER Rating Price Range (Unit Only) Warranty
GSX140481 14 SEER $1,800 – $2,400 10 Years (Parts/Compressor)
GSX160481 16 SEER $2,000 – $2,700 10 Years (Parts/Compressor)
GSXV90481 18 SEER $2,600 – $3,200 10 Years (Parts/Compressor)

Note: These are unit-only prices from major suppliers. Discounts may apply for off-season purchases or promotional deals.

What Affects Goodman 4 Ton AC Installation Cost?

The installation cost is often as significant as the price of the unit itself. Several factors shape the total expense, which typically covers labor, materials, and additional services.

  • Home Size & Layout: Larger or multi-level homes may increase installation complexity.
  • Ductwork Condition: Existing, adequate ductwork can reduce costs, while duct renovations or new installations add to the bill.
  • Location: Labor costs vary by region. Urban areas tend to have higher rates compared to rural locations.
  • Permits & Disposal: Local permits and removal of old equipment may contribute additional fees.
  • Additional Equipment: Adding a furnace, air handler, or zoning system will raise total costs.

Goodman 4 Ton AC Unit With Installation: Pricing Table

The combined cost of both the unit and its professional installation is what most homeowners pay attention to. The following table summarizes typical price ranges by installation complexity:

Scenario Unit Price Installation Cost Total Price
Basic Replacement (existing ductwork, standard install) $2,000 $3,200 $5,200
Standard Install (minor duct adjustments) $2,300 $3,900 $6,200
Full System (new ductwork) $2,500 $5,500 $8,000

Insight: National averages suggest that total installed costs range from $5,000 to $8,500 for most Goodman 4 ton setups.

Comparing Goodman With Competing Brands

When budgeting for a central AC, it’s useful to compare Goodman 4 ton units with equivalent models from leading competitors. This helps clarify where Goodman sits on the spectrum of cost and value.

Brand Average Unit Price Average Installed Cost Warranty SEER Ratings
Goodman $2,000 – $3,200 $5,000 – $8,500 10 Years 14-18
Trane $2,800 – $4,000 $6,500 – $11,000 10 Years 14-22
Carrier $2,900 – $4,200 $6,800 – $10,500 10 Years 14-21
Lennox $3,200 – $4,500 $7,200 – $12,000 10 Years 14-26
Rheem $2,700 – $3,900 $6,000 – $9,500 10 Years 14-20

Highlight: As the table shows, Goodman units typically offer the lowest initial and installed costs, while maintaining competitive warranties and efficiency ratings.

Energy Efficiency And Long-Term Value

S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) impacts not just upfront cost, but also ongoing utility bills. Higher SEER-rated 4 ton units require a greater initial investment but can result in substantial savings over the system’s lifespan.

  • 14-16 SEER: Standard for many homes, strikes a balance between cost and efficiency.
  • 17-18 SEER: Premium efficiency, suitable for those prioritizing energy savings.
  • Utility Rebates: Some higher-SEER models may qualify for local or federal rebates, reducing net cost.

Investing in a higher SEER unit is advisable when long-term operational costs are a primary concern.

Installation Process And What To Expect

Knowing what the installation entails can help homeowners prepare for the process and understand cost breakdowns. Proper installation is crucial for optimal AC performance.

  1. Site Inspection: Installer evaluates home layout, duct condition, and existing equipment.
  2. Permitting: Necessary local permits are secured for system replacement or upgrade.
  3. Old Equipment Removal: Previous unit and materials are safely removed and disposed.
  4. Unit Placement & Connection: Goodman AC is positioned, refrigerant lines connected, electrical hooked up, and ductwork joined if needed.
  5. Testing & Balancing: Technicians test for refrigerant leaks, pressure, thermostat calibration, and airflow balance.
  6. Final Walkthrough: Homeowner is briefed on new system operation, and warranties are registered.
